In 2015 Tiger 131 will only make two appearances in our arena; Tiger Day – 2nd May and Tankfest 27th & 28th June. As the only running Tiger 1 tank in the world you really can't afford to miss it!

The Museum will open at 10.00am with a range of World War Two talks and tours taking place throughout the day, including the opportunity to get close to Tiger.

The Vehicle Conservation Centre will be open from 10am – 5pm allowing access to the main floor, this allows visitors unprecedented access to the museum’s extended collection of tanks and other military vehicles.

The highlight of the day will be at 1.30pm, when Tiger 131 makes its return into the Kuwait arena*. The 30 minute display will examine and compare this World War Two beast to its Axis and Allied contemporaries; including Matilda II, Panzer III, T-34 and Sherman. The display will also examine the impact Tiger had on future tank design, with Centurion and Leopard*.
